Webb20 sep. 2024 · In spring, nearly every garden center sells potted hibiscus, either pruned into small trees, or multi-stemmed and shrub-like, with their distinctive flower form. These are tropical hibiscus, sometimes called Chinese Hibiscus whose botanical species is Hibiscus rosa-sinensis. And they are wonderful plants for decks and patios. We can learn much … WebbPruning and training Propagation Cultivar Selection Problems Cultivation notes Hibiscus requires bright, humid conditions with good ventilation, protected from direct sunlight and a minimum night temperature of 7ºC (45ºF). Plants can be placed outdoors in summer but need to be brought indoors before temperatures drop below 12ºC (59ºF).

Webb20 jan. 2024 · To correctly prune a hibiscus plant, first, you need to find a node and trim the branch 1/4th inch above the node. Don’t prune more than 1/3rd or 1/4th of the plant, but trim the dead, damaged parts and leggy limbs. Pruning the plant encourages new growth in the hibiscus plant. Hibiscus roots are tender and fragile and are very susceptible to root rot. The soil and pot you choose to grow your hibiscus in is critical. The soil needs to be light and fluffy with lots of air in it. Major hibiscus pruning should be done in early spring. Make minor cuts to branches pointing outward and above a node during the spring and summer. Within these seasonal guidelines, adjust pruning depending on the specific needs of your plant. dax window functionsWebb24 mars 2024 · The Braided Hibiscus can grow as large as 6 feet tall and 4 feet wide, but it can be kept to a more manageable size with frequent pruning.
